Glenn Fabry is an Eisner Award-winning British comics artist known for his detailed, realistic work in both ink and painted colour.
Glenn Fabry's career began in 1985, drawing Sláine for 2000 AD, with writer Pat Mills. Glenn is known for his association with writer Garth Ennis, painting the covers for the Vertigo series Preacher, and illustrating Ennis-written stories in The Authority and Thor.
